From 899a433458aeefc0abbaed036a9a92293f234cab Mon Sep 17 00:00:00 2001
From: Adam Reichold <adam.reichold@t-online.de>
Date: Sat, 8 Feb 2025 09:16:30 +0100
Subject: [PATCH] Drop metaver-sh and metaver-ni as they have been cleared from
 the catalog and are not listed on https://metaver.de/startseite#panel-state
 anymore.

---
 deployment/harvester.toml | 36 ++++++++----------------------------
 deployment/origins.toml   |  7 -------
 2 files changed, 8 insertions(+), 35 deletions(-)

diff --git a/deployment/harvester.toml b/deployment/harvester.toml
index 019236a099..8fbc989c2e 100644
--- a/deployment/harvester.toml
+++ b/deployment/harvester.toml
@@ -241,7 +241,7 @@ source_url = "https://geomis.sachsen.de/geomis-client/?lang=de#/datasets/iso/{{i
 name = "metaver-st"
 type = "csw"
 url = 'https://metaver.de/csw?CONSTRAINTLANGUAGE=Filter&constraint_language_version=1.1.0&constraint=<ogc:Filter xmlns:ogc="http://www.opengis.net/ogc"><ogc:PropertyIsEqualTo><ogc:PropertyName>partner</ogc:PropertyName><ogc:Literal>st</ogc:Literal></ogc:PropertyIsEqualTo></ogc:Filter>'
-origins = ["/Bund/MetaVer/Sachsen-Anhalt", "/Land/Sachsen-Anhalt/MetaVer"]
+origins = ["/Land/Sachsen-Anhalt/MetaVer"]
 source_url = "https://metaver.de/trefferanzeige?docuuid={{id}}"
 max_age = "1w"
 age_smear = "3d"
@@ -251,7 +251,7 @@ tier = 2
 name = "metaver-sl"
 type = "csw"
 url = 'https://metaver.de/csw?CONSTRAINTLANGUAGE=Filter&constraint_language_version=1.1.0&constraint=<ogc:Filter xmlns:ogc="http://www.opengis.net/ogc"><ogc:PropertyIsEqualTo><ogc:PropertyName>partner</ogc:PropertyName><ogc:Literal>sl</ogc:Literal></ogc:PropertyIsEqualTo></ogc:Filter>'
-origins = ["/Bund/MetaVer/Saarland", "/Land/Saarland/MetaVer"]
+origins = ["/Land/Saarland/MetaVer"]
 source_url = "https://metaver.de/trefferanzeige?docuuid={{id}}"
 max_age = "1w"
 age_smear = "3d"
@@ -261,7 +261,7 @@ tier = 2
 name = "metaver-hh"
 type = "csw"
 url = 'https://metaver.de/csw?CONSTRAINTLANGUAGE=Filter&constraint_language_version=1.1.0&constraint=<ogc:Filter xmlns:ogc="http://www.opengis.net/ogc"><ogc:PropertyIsEqualTo><ogc:PropertyName>partner</ogc:PropertyName><ogc:Literal>hh</ogc:Literal></ogc:PropertyIsEqualTo></ogc:Filter>'
-origins = ["/Bund/MetaVer/Hamburg", "/Land/Hamburg/MetaVer"]
+origins = ["/Land/Hamburg/MetaVer"]
 source_url = "https://metaver.de/trefferanzeige?docuuid={{id}}"
 max_age = "1w"
 age_smear = "3d"
@@ -271,17 +271,7 @@ tier = 2
 name = "metaver-mv"
 type = "csw"
 url = 'https://metaver.de/csw?CONSTRAINTLANGUAGE=Filter&constraint_language_version=1.1.0&constraint=<ogc:Filter xmlns:ogc="http://www.opengis.net/ogc"><ogc:PropertyIsEqualTo><ogc:PropertyName>partner</ogc:PropertyName><ogc:Literal>mv</ogc:Literal></ogc:PropertyIsEqualTo></ogc:Filter>'
-origins = ["/Bund/MetaVer/Mecklenburg-Vorpommern", "/Land/Mecklenburg-Vorpommern/MetaVer"]
-source_url = "https://metaver.de/trefferanzeige?docuuid={{id}}"
-max_age = "1w"
-age_smear = "3d"
-tier = 2
-
-[[sources]]
-name = "metaver-ni"
-type = "csw"
-url = 'https://metaver.de/csw?CONSTRAINTLANGUAGE=Filter&constraint_language_version=1.1.0&constraint=<ogc:Filter xmlns:ogc="http://www.opengis.net/ogc"><ogc:PropertyIsEqualTo><ogc:PropertyName>partner</ogc:PropertyName><ogc:Literal>ni</ogc:Literal></ogc:PropertyIsEqualTo></ogc:Filter>'
-origins = ["/Bund/MetaVer/Niedersachsen"]
+origins = ["/Land/Mecklenburg-Vorpommern/MetaVer"]
 source_url = "https://metaver.de/trefferanzeige?docuuid={{id}}"
 max_age = "1w"
 age_smear = "3d"
@@ -291,7 +281,7 @@ tier = 2
 name = "metaver-sn"
 type = "csw"
 url = 'https://metaver.de/csw?CONSTRAINTLANGUAGE=Filter&constraint_language_version=1.1.0&constraint=<ogc:Filter xmlns:ogc="http://www.opengis.net/ogc"><ogc:PropertyIsEqualTo><ogc:PropertyName>partner</ogc:PropertyName><ogc:Literal>sn</ogc:Literal></ogc:PropertyIsEqualTo></ogc:Filter>'
-origins = ["/Bund/MetaVer/Sachsen", "/Land/Sachsen/MetaVer"]
+origins = ["/Land/Sachsen/MetaVer"]
 source_url = "https://metaver.de/trefferanzeige?docuuid={{id}}"
 max_age = "1w"
 age_smear = "3d"
@@ -301,7 +291,7 @@ tier = 2
 name = "metaver-hb"
 type = "csw"
 url = 'https://metaver.de/csw?CONSTRAINTLANGUAGE=Filter&constraint_language_version=1.1.0&constraint=<ogc:Filter xmlns:ogc="http://www.opengis.net/ogc"><ogc:PropertyIsEqualTo><ogc:PropertyName>partner</ogc:PropertyName><ogc:Literal>hb</ogc:Literal></ogc:PropertyIsEqualTo></ogc:Filter>'
-origins = ["/Bund/MetaVer/Bremen", "/Land/Bremen/MetaVer"]
+origins = ["/Land/Bremen/MetaVer"]
 source_url = "https://metaver.de/trefferanzeige?docuuid={{id}}"
 max_age = "1w"
 age_smear = "3d"
@@ -311,17 +301,7 @@ tier = 2
 name = "metaver-bb"
 type = "csw"
 url = 'https://metaver.de/csw?CONSTRAINTLANGUAGE=Filter&constraint_language_version=1.1.0&constraint=<ogc:Filter xmlns:ogc="http://www.opengis.net/ogc"><ogc:PropertyIsEqualTo><ogc:PropertyName>partner</ogc:PropertyName><ogc:Literal>bb</ogc:Literal></ogc:PropertyIsEqualTo></ogc:Filter>'
-origins = ["/Bund/MetaVer/Brandenburg", "/Land/Brandenburg/MetaVer"]
-source_url = "https://metaver.de/trefferanzeige?docuuid={{id}}"
-max_age = "1w"
-age_smear = "3d"
-tier = 2
-
-[[sources]]
-name = "metaver-sh"
-type = "csw"
-url = 'https://metaver.de/csw?CONSTRAINTLANGUAGE=Filter&constraint_language_version=1.1.0&constraint=<ogc:Filter xmlns:ogc="http://www.opengis.net/ogc"><ogc:PropertyIsEqualTo><ogc:PropertyName>partner</ogc:PropertyName><ogc:Literal>sh</ogc:Literal></ogc:PropertyIsEqualTo></ogc:Filter>'
-origins = ["/Bund/MetaVer/Schleswig-Holstein"]
+origins = ["/Land/Brandenburg/MetaVer"]
 source_url = "https://metaver.de/trefferanzeige?docuuid={{id}}"
 max_age = "1w"
 age_smear = "3d"
@@ -331,7 +311,7 @@ tier = 2
 name = "metaver-he"
 type = "csw"
 url = 'https://metaver.de/csw?CONSTRAINTLANGUAGE=Filter&constraint_language_version=1.1.0&constraint=<ogc:Filter xmlns:ogc="http://www.opengis.net/ogc"><ogc:PropertyIsEqualTo><ogc:PropertyName>partner</ogc:PropertyName><ogc:Literal>he</ogc:Literal></ogc:PropertyIsEqualTo></ogc:Filter>'
-origins = ["/Bund/MetaVer/Hessen", "/Land/Hessen/MetaVer"]
+origins = ["/Land/Hessen/MetaVer"]
 source_url = "https://metaver.de/trefferanzeige?docuuid={{id}}"
 max_age = "1w"
 age_smear = "3d"
diff --git a/deployment/origins.toml b/deployment/origins.toml
index a873de00b8..e1b1ee3f56 100644
--- a/deployment/origins.toml
+++ b/deployment/origins.toml
@@ -402,13 +402,6 @@ contact_url = "https://metaver.de/kontakt"
 email = "support@metaver.de"
 description = "MetaVer ist ein gemeinsames Portal der Bundesländer Brandenburg, Bremen, Hamburg, Hessen, Mecklenburg-Vorpommern, Saarland, Sachsen und Sachsen-Anhalt. Es dient als zentraler Zugangspunkt zu den Metadaten der beteiligten Länder."
 
-["Bund/MetaVer/*"]
-name = "MetaVer"
-about_url= "https://metaver.de/impressum"
-contact_url = "https://metaver.de/kontakt"
-email = "support@metaver.de"
-description = "MetaVer ist ein gemeinsames Portal der Bundesländer Brandenburg, Bremen, Hamburg, Hessen, Mecklenburg-Vorpommern, Saarland, Sachsen und Sachsen-Anhalt. Es dient als zentraler Zugangspunkt zu den Metadaten der beteiligten Länder."
-
 ["Bund/BfN/Naturdetektive"]
 name = "Naturdetektive"
 about_url = "https://naturdetektive.bfn.de/fuer-erwachsene.html"
-- 
GitLab